Originally Posted by Kika
Leander,

Why did you replace the O2 sensor? were you getting a CEL? or just preventative? what interval do you change them?

Thanks
I got a CEL codes P0154 and P1119. I first checked the wires connection before changing just the one sensor. Car has 115k miles. I read somewhere they typically need replacing around 90-100k, so I expect to have to do the other three soon.
